What is the User Interface?5 answersThe user interface is the portion of an interactive computer system that communicates with the user. It includes any aspect of the system that is visible to the user. In the past, computer interfaces consisted of jumper wires, punched cards, and batch printouts. Today, with the widespread use of computers by nonspecialists, keyboards, mice, and graphical displays are the most common interface hardware. The user interface is becoming a larger and more important portion of the software in a computer system as more people use computers. The user interface can be defined as everything concerning the human side of information systems, including human factors and human-computer interaction. It encompasses the social dimension of information systems development. The user interface is the point in the system where a human being interacts with a computer. It can incorporate hardware, software, procedures, and data.

What is the meaning of term "alumni"?
5 answers
The term "alumni" refers to individuals who have graduated from a college or university. Alumni play a crucial role in maintaining the image and quality of educational institutions. They often form a network that can benefit both the alumni themselves and their alma mater. Alumni are valuable assets for higher education institutions, providing opportunities for partnerships and synergies that can enhance the overall educational experience. Furthermore, alumni can contribute to curriculum development by offering evaluations and feedback on their post-graduation experiences, helping to improve the quality of education provided by universities. Overall, alumni are seen as a vital link between educational institutions and the broader community, offering a wealth of knowledge and experience that can benefit current students and faculty alike.

What is graphical user interface design?
5 answers
Graphical User Interface (GUI) design is the process of creating visual representations of user interfaces to enhance user experience and interaction with software systems. It involves elements like visual appearance, color, font, and layout to make interfaces aesthetically pleasing, easy to understand, and user-friendly. GUI design plays a crucial role in defining how users interact with digital platforms, affecting usability and accessibility. Different types of interfaces, such as command-based, object-oriented, and expert system interfaces, offer varying levels of user interaction and require different design approaches. GUI design for interactive platforms like web browsers or remotely operated vehicles involves selecting or generating components, associating data values, and enabling dynamic changes to components based on received data. Overall, GUI design aims to optimize user comfort, intuitive navigation, and efficient communication between users and machines.
